Welcome Ben!

Judging tyre wear on a car you just bought is difficult, the previous owner could have just thrown anything on to sell it. That said, rubber suspension components if original are now 15 years old so that may account for it as well. Probably needs a really close eye over the whole suspension system and replacing items as needed. It's really not unusual for a 15 year old Z3 to still have original suspension components still fitted. We even see the 20 year old ones with original shock absorbers on them.
